CRYSTAL STRUCTURE OF E96K MUTATED BETA-GLUCOSIDASE A FROM BACILLUS POLYMYXA, AN ENZYME WITH INCREASED THERMORESISTANCE
Template:ABSTRACT PUBMED 9466926
About this Structure
1TR1 is a Single protein structure of sequence from Paenibacillus polymyxa. Full crystallographic information is available from OCA.
Reference
Crystal structure of beta-glucosidase A from Bacillus polymyxa: insights into the catalytic activity in family 1 glycosyl hydrolases., Sanz-Aparicio J, Hermoso JA, Martinez-Ripoll M, Lequerica JL, Polaina J, J Mol Biol. 1998 Jan 23;275(3):491-502. PMID:9466926
